Job Summary
Performs non-invasive, routine, technical support services under the specific authorization and supervision of a licensed physician, podiatrist, physician assistant, nurse practitioner or nurse midwife.
Job Requirements
Education and Work Experience
- High School Education/GED or equivalent: Required
Licenses/Certifications
- Certified Medical Assistant (CMA) or Registered Medical Assistant (RMA) or equivalent combination of licensure and experience: Preferred
- Basic Life Support (BLS) Health Care Provider certification from approved vendor per AH policy: Required
- Successful completion of audiometry and vision training or have a certificate from CHDP within six months of hire.: Preferred
- Phlebotomy certificate: Preferred
Facility Specific License/Certifications
- Basic Life Support (BLS) certification from approved vendor per AH policy: Required
Essential Functions
- Sets up exam rooms and checks in patients. Maintains a patient recall system, including continuity of care log for lab tests, referrals and transfers.
- Obtains vital signs. Reports significant findings and pertinent patient observations to clinic physician.
- Performs venipunctures as ordered.
- Performs audiometry and vision testing.
- Performs other job-related duties as assigned.
This role will support clinic operations by coordinating appointments, processing medication refill requests, and managing verification inquiries in a non-patient-facing environment.
